Question How are healthcare teams handling HIPAA audit trails for AI agents accessing PHI?

Healthcare organizations deploying AI agents — how are you handling HIPAA audit trail requirements for AI agent PHI access? The 2025 Security Rule amendments made encryption mandatory and expanded what counts as a required technical control. Curious how teams are approaching tamper-evident logging for agent actions.

If the agent or engine doesnt provide an audit trail, we dont use it. Part of our P&P for AI prohibits use of tools that dont provide transparency. Weeds out about 99% of fly-by-night AI vendors.

If accountability isnt built into your product, find another customer. I have no interest in sitting across a table from an CISSP or Insurance Auditor trying to explain why I decided to take on a product so dangerous.
